## Tax-Rate Lookup Cache

The Copperdale service caches jurisdiction tax rates in an in-memory LRU with a 24-hour TTL, refreshed nightly from the Marleyfort rates feed. Never bypass the cache in request paths; stale entries are acceptable per finance policy. Manual invalidation requires a change ticket. For cache questions or invalidation requests, write to the address below.

escalation mailbox, hafop-fahop: ralix_oliael@qirvanlabs.internal

Nightly reindex for the Larkfield search cluster kicks off at 02:00 via the Siftwell scheduler. It rebuilds all shards into a staging index, validates document counts, then swaps the alias. If the swap fails, the old index stays live and an alert fires. Manual reruns require authenticating to Siftwell with the operations key shown below.

app token of yajeg-kawef = kto11_7En3XSX8xQw

### Catalogue Import: Pre-run checks

The Shelfwright catalogue importer ingests nightly record batches from partner libraries and merges them into the main index. Before starting a manual run, confirm the previous batch finished cleanly and the dedupe queue is empty — re-running over a partial batch creates duplicate holdings that are painful to unwind. Once those checks pass, start the importer with the configuration values below.

settings of fafog-haduf:
ZORIX_PIN=4648
ZORIX_METRICS_HOST=metrics.zorix.paliqsys.corp
ZORIX_LOG_LEVEL=info
ZORIX_TENANT=druix

Subject: Handover — Nightglass backfill scheduler

Hi Perrin,

Passing you the Nightglass scheduler watch. Nightly backfills ran clean except one plugin-stage timeout; plugin authors should know retries now cap at three with exponential backoff. Please note this in the external changelog before Thursday. All configs are versioned in the scheduler repo. Questions from plugin authors can be sent to the team inbox below.

billing contact of bagef-kawef = prawyn@lumicnet.test